King receives 4-H scholarship

ODESSA - A local student-athlete will eceive the Lincoln-Adams 4-H Scholarship this year.

Marcus King, a 10-year mem-ber of the Junior Live-stock 4-H Club, will receive the $500 scholarship to be used toward his future college education.

King, who graduates July 18, plans to attend University of Idaho and major in agribusiness or crop management.

He is the son of Todd and Terri King of Odessa.

King's 4-H projects focused on beef production. He has exhibited market steers at the Lincoln County Fair.

The Odessa Club has received the Commissioner's Award several times in recent years. King believes he contributed to that effort by setting an example for all beef kids to be at the barn early during the fair, taking good care of the cattle , helping others with their animals, decorating the stall area, assisting the Beef Barn superintendent and by approaching all fair activities with a great attitude.

King served as the Odessa Junior Livestock 4-H president in 2017-18.

Other 4-H Club activities include Odessa Community Christmas Fest set-up, fair Club Steer Barn leader and the Lead4Change service project, Toasty Tots, which raised money to assist in providing warm winter clothing for area youth.

King has served as team captain for all three major high school boys sports - football, basketball and baseball.

He was a member and officer of Future Business Leaders of America, band, Knowledge Bowl, National Honor Society, and Associated Student Body as the student council representative.

King also works for King Hay Farms, Inc.
